CANDIDATE BACKGROUND
Representative Jim Costa is running for a twelfth term to represent California’s 21st Congressional District. In Congress, he has helped secure $3.3 billion to advance California’s High-Speed Rail and $21 million to purchase zero-emission, clean school buses in Fresno, Orosi and Selma.
